The 3136 postcode, which includes Croydon, Croydon Hills, Croydon North and Croydon South, has 18,591 households. Of these, 4,832 homes — or 26.0% — have installed rooftop solar panels, reflecting the community's growing move toward renewable energy. With more Croydon residents looking to reduce their reliance on the electricity grid, many are now turning to solar battery storage as the next step. Solar batteries help homeowners lower energy bills, increase energy independence, and improve long-term sustainability.
According to daily average sunshine data from the nearest weather station at Croydon (samuel Street), households in this community receive approximately 4.1 kWh of sunlight per day. Across 3136, rooftop solar systems collectively generate approximately 33,486,000 kWh of clean energy each year, based on an average system size of 5.5 kW. At current electricity rates, that's equivalent to around $10,045,800 of clean energy at grid electricity costs annually.
Solar Battery energy storage is growing just as rapidly, with 92 battery systems now installed across 3136. Together, these systems provide 828 kWh of stored energy capacity, with the average household storing around 9.0 kWh. This means local solar households can typically power their homes for 3.6 hours each night using clean energy they generated themselves during the day.
So instead of sending excess solar energy back to the grid for lower returns, Croydon homeowners are now storing and using their own clean power around the clock. This smart approach not only reduces reliance on expensive coal-generated electricity from the grid, it protects against blackouts, improves sustainability, and maximises their solar investment and long-term financial returns.

Popular battery brands installed in the area include Tesla (13.5 kWh), BYD (13.8 kWh), and Sungrow (9.6 kWh), each offering reliable performance and flexible options. Typical annual bill savings in Croydon look like this:
• 6–8 kWh system: $1,200–$1,500 saved per year • 10–14 kWh system: $1,700–$2,200 saved per year • 15–20+ kWh system: $2,200–$2,800+ saved per year

Interest in solar batteries, battery storage, and Virtual Power Plants (VPPs) is only growing in Croydon. The Victorian Government’s solar batteries rebate program means eligible homeowners can claim up to 30% off the solar batteries cost—often $3,400–$4,000 off a typical 11.5–13.5 kWh battery system. This support can halve payback periods to just 3–4 years, making battery storage more accessible than ever. By joining a VPP, Croydon residents can also boost their returns and help stabilise the local grid, further enhancing community resilience.
